  2.   Source:Bolton, Ethel Stanwood. Some Descendants of John Moore of Sudbury, Mass, p. 57:302, adds Benjamin, "perhaps a son" m. 1728 Zerviah Moore. The Sudbury VRsS1 show a record "More, Zebiah and Benjamin Stow, June 4, 1728. [Benjamin How, M.R.]", which appears to be the source that might have prompted this comment. However, it is not at all clear that Moore is the correct interpretation of Benjamin's surname. No births are recorded in the Moore section of Sudbury VRs that would match this marriage, but several children are recorded to a Benjamin and Zebiah/Sebiah/Zibiah Stow over the period 1729-1741, on p. 140. In the list of deeds given by Bolton where the father Benjamin Moore devises his lands amongst his son, there is no mention of a son Benjamin. Nor is there an obvious place for Benjamin's birth to fit amongst the other siblings, assuming he is older than his wife who was b. 1704 (and who would have been the daughter of one of his cousins).
